In 1989 the U.S. Environmental Protection Agency began to enforce regulations on TCE (Trichloroethylene) levels in drinking water because of its negative health effects. A major US air conditioning manufacturer detected levels as high as 100 parts per million (ppm) of TCE (Trichloroethylene) in a water stream.
